The trend toward personalizing travel is stronger than ever. Recent data shows travelers—especially millennials and Gen Z—are prioritizing authentic, flexible experiences over rigid itineraries. Florida, with its sprawling highways, coastal drives, and iconic attractions, offers the perfect canvas. Beyond convenience, renting a car lets visitors maximize time, visit remote beaches, national parks, and small towns not easily reached by transit. Social media amplifies this shift: travelers increasingly showcase their custom road trips, fueling interest in skip rental experiences that blend style, freedom, and spontaneity.

The process is simpler than many expect. With major rental agencies offering dedicated services nationwide, Florida’s network provides a wide selection—from compact sedans to spacious SUVs—perfectly suited to diverse travel styles. Most companies streamline booking via mobile apps, enabling instant reservations, competitive pricing, and easy pick-up at airports or city centers.
Florida’s traffic laws prioritize defensive driving. Clear rental instructions, GPS navigation apps, and easy access to roadside assistance make solo driving more confident.
